Whatever part you play youll be helping us deliver operational excellence to our customers.We are currently seeking a Maintenance Engineer to join us at our modern manufacturing facility inWestern Approach. This site is an International Centre of Excellence in composite wing structure design and production, manufacturing composite wing spars and Fixed Trailing Edge assemblies for some of the world’s most popular aircrafts.The Maintenance Engineer will be accountable for applying engineering concepts for the optimization of assets, procedures and departmental budgets to achieve better maintainability, reliability, and availability. The function role includes safe working at all times, planning, managing and performing machinery and building asset care.This is a multi-skilled role covering both electrical and mechanical aspects of equipment breakdown.The successful applicant will work as part of a team of 4 maintenance engineers on a 7 day fortnight shift basis, inclusive of 28% shift allowance -Week 1: Monday, Tuesday, Friday, Saturday, SundayWeek 2: Wednesday, ThursdayHow You’ll Contribute
